Classic Pastrami Sandwich
Ingredients:
- 2 slices of rye bread
- 4-6 slices of Boar's Head Pastrami
- 1 tablespoon of mustard
- 1 tablespoon of sauerkraut
- 1 slice of Swiss cheese
Instructions:
- Toast the rye bread to your desired level of crispiness.
- Spread mustard on one slice of bread.
- Layer the Boar's Head Pastrami slices on top of the mustard.
- Add a layer of sauerkraut.
- Place the Swiss cheese on top of the sauerkraut.
- Top with the second slice of bread and serve.
Pastrami and Cheese Omelette
Ingredients:
- 3 eggs
- 2 slices of Boar's Head Pastrami
- 1 slice of cheddar cheese
- 1 tablespoon of butter
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ions:
- Beat the eggs in a bowl and season with salt and pepper.
- Melt the butter in a non-stick pan over medium heat.
- Pour the beaten eggs into the pan and let them cook until the bottom is set.
- Place the Boar's Head Pastrami slices and cheddar cheese on one half of the omelette.
- Fold the other half of the omelette over the filling.
- Cook for another minute or two until the cheese is melted and the eggs are fully cooked.
- Slide the omelette onto a plate and serve.
Pastrami and Vegetable Stir-Fry
Ingredients:
- 2 slices of Boar's Head Pastrami
- 1 bell pepper, sliced
- 1 onion, sliced
- 1 cup of broccoli florets
- 2 tablespoons of soy sauce
- 1 tablespoon of vegetable oil
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ions:
- Heat the vegetable oil in a large skillet over medium heat.
- Add the sliced bell pepper, onion, and broccoli florets. Cook until the vegetables are tender.
- Cut the Boar's Head Pastrami into thin strips and add to the skillet.
- Pour the soy sauce over the mixture and stir well.
- Cook for another 2-3 minutes until the pastrami is heated through.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Serve hot over rice or noodles.
